For Australian and Non Australian people viewing this website, I would like to ask you not to take the site too seriously, basically this website has a message to all Australians and also people of other Commonwealth countries that we need to be aware of how we are losing our unique languages to “American Lingo” or Americanisms.

A prime example of this is how the term “Santa” and “Santa Claus” has jumped into our everyday language without us even realising…. thus the term “Father Christmas” is rarely used these days when referring to him in front of our children, neices, nephews and so forth.

It bothers me a great deal when I hear Santa this and Santa that, thats exactly the reason why I decided to create this Save Father Christmas website.

Yes, you might say, who cares, there are far more important things in life? Yes I know that, but you should care about the message this site gives, I can guarantee you that it wont be long until we Australians, English and New Zealanders are celebrating Thanksgiving! I reckon probably within the next 5 to 10 years that we will be celebrating Thanksgiving, just for the sake of celebrating it, and because the media and large shopping outlets can make millions and millions of dollars out of it.

Already Halloween has been introduced into our Australian Culture over the last few years, and just like the term Santa Claus has.

Who can we blame for this? Obviously the number one culprit would have to be the commercialised media, and also as I mentioned above, the large mega shopping chains make millions of dollars from us, whether it be us buying stuff for Halloween, and other celebratory events that are not even relevant to our culture.

Like I say, our language is too important to lose, not only is Santa an example, but many times over the last couple of years I have heard Australians using the terms “Bathroom” in stead of Toilet, “Ketchup” instead of Tomato Sauce, “Trash Can” instead of rubbish bins and so on … just listen to people talking and I am sure you will hear American words being used in our language.

Santa Given his marching orders!

October 22nd, 2007

Vienna - Santa Claus is being banned from Christmas markets in the European countries of Germany and Austria.

Anti-Santa campaigners say that Father Christmas was invented by Coca-Cola and detracts from the true spirit of the festive season.

Austria’s biggest Christmas market is in front of the Vienna city hall where thousands of visitors stroll past stalls offering everything related to Christmas - everything, that is, except Santa.

The only Father Christmas to be seen is the one in the middle of the occasional “Ban Santa” stickers.

http://www.int.iol.co.za/index.php?set_id=1&click_id=29&art_id=iol1164635828280A532

A Vienna city hall spokesperson said: “There are rules governing what stallholders can do and one of them is to agree not to use the image of Santa as a condition of being able to trade there.

“Santa is an English language creation, people who want to see him should go to America where I am sure Coca Cola will be happy to oblige.”

The move in Vienna has been copied by Christmas markets across Austria and Germany where St Nicholas is the traditional bearer of Christmas gifts.

Bettina Schade, from the Frankfurter Nicholas Initiative in Germany, commented: “We object to the material things, the hectic rush to buy gifts, and the ubiquity of the bearded man in the red suit that are taking away from the core meaning of Christmas.

“The Christian origins of Christmas, like the birth of Jesus, have receded into the background. It’s becoming more and more a festival that is reduced to simply worldly gifts and commerce.” - Ananova.com

 Political Correctness

Political correctness (PC or politically correct) is a term used to describe language, ideas, policies, or behaviour seen as seeking to minimize offence to racial, cultural, or other identity groups. The term is also used in a broader sense to describe adherence to any political or cultural orthodoxy. Conversely, the term politically incorrect is used to refer to language or ideas that may cause offense; or that are unconstrained by orthodoxy.

The term itself and its usage are hotly contested. The term “political correctness” is used almost exclusively in a pejorative sense.[Those who use the term in a critical fashion often express a concern that public discourse, academia, and the sciences have been dominated by excessive liberal viewpoints.

Some commentators, usually on the political left, have argued that the term “political correctness” is a straw man invented by the New Right to discredit progressive social change, especially around issues of race and gender
